Kinds of Track Shoes



When considering the numerous kinds of track shoes for hefty equipment, it is important to review their layout and capability in regard to specific operational requirements. Track footwear are vital components of the undercarriage system, offering grip, weight, and security circulation for heavy machinery such as excavators, bulldozers, and spider cranes.


The most common kinds of track footwear include:

** Criterion Track Shoes **: These are suitable and versatile for various terrains, supplying a balance between traction and maker weight circulation.


** Grouser Shoes **: Featuring increased metal bars (grousers) along the footwear's surface, these track shoes offer enhanced grip in tough terrains like mud, snow, and loosened gravel. undercarriage parts.


** Double Grouser Shoes **: Similar to grouser footwear but with an added collection of grousers, these track footwear use also better traction and security, making them perfect for extremely harsh terrains.


** Triple Grouser Shoes **: With three collections of grousers, these track footwear supply optimal traction and stability, making them suitable for the most demanding conditions.


Choosing the appropriate kind of track shoe is essential for optimizing the efficiency and durability of heavy machinery while ensuring safety and security and effectiveness throughout procedures.

Maintenance Tips for Undercarriage Components



Efficient maintenance of undercarriage elements is necessary for making sure the durability and optimum performance of hefty equipment. Regular evaluation of undercarriage components such as track chains, rollers, idlers, gears, and track shoes is essential to stop unanticipated failures and expensive repair services. One crucial maintenance tip is to maintain the undercarriage tidy from particles, mud, look at this website and various other impurities that can increase wear and deterioration. It is also essential to make sure correct track stress to stop premature wear on elements. Greasing the undercarriage parts at suggested periods assists to minimize rubbing and prolong the life expectancy of the parts. Keeping an eye on for any type of uncommon noises, vibrations, or adjustments in machine performance can indicate potential concerns with the undercarriage that call for instant interest. By following these maintenance tips diligently, heavy machinery drivers can minimize downtime, minimize operating costs, and optimize the performance of their devices.
